Background: Vitamin D deficiency in pregnant women constitutes a significant obstetric concern, affecting 40-98% of gravid populations worldwide. Adequate vitamin D status is essential for successful pregnancy outcomes, fetal development, and maternal health.
Objective: This review analyzes current evidence regarding vitamin D deficiency during pregnancy from an obstetric perspective, focusing on pregnancy complications, fetal outcomes, and evidence-based supplementation strategies for clinical practice.
Methods: A systematic review of PubMed, Scopus, and Cochrane databases was conducted, encompassing publications from 2020-2025. Randomized controlled trials, meta-analyses, and prospective cohort studies examining vitamin D status and pregnancy outcomes were included.
Results: Analysis demonstrated significant associations between vitamin D deficiency (< 50 nmol/L) and elevated risk of preeclampsia (OR 0.65), gestational diabetes mellitus (OR 1.61), preterm birth (RR 0.67), and small-for-gestational-age neonates (RR 0.61). Supplementation with 2000-4000 IU/day appears safe and efficacious in achieving optimal concentrations.
Conclusions: Vitamin D assessment and individualized supplementation should be integrated into routine prenatal care. Obstetricians should implement screening protocols particularly for high-risk pregnant women.
